Things To Do
in Curtorim
Curtorim is a serene village located in the state of Goa, India, known for its lush greenery and tranquil atmosphere. Nestled along the banks of the River Zuari, it offers a glimpse into traditional Goan life away from the bustling tourist spots. The village is characterized by its charming churches, paddy fields, and friendly locals, making it a perfect getaway for those seeking peace.
Curtorim serves as a gateway to explore the natural beauty and cultural richness of Goa.
